Abstract(in English) We propose a novel image abstraction method in which one-dimensional vector ε-filter is applied to an input image along a space-filling curve constructed by using a minimum spanning tree reflecting structural context of the input image. The structural-context-preserving image abstraction capability of the proposed method is verified by some comparisons with conventional image abstraction methods.
